- Do you have a personal message for students?
- I would like to adopt a teaching method where I would instruct my student to complete exercises or worksheets during the tuition session where if they should have any questions, I would be able to aid the student in answering those questions such that they obtain a fuller understanding of the subject matter. I feel that this is a good method to adopt as I would be exposing the student to a wider variety of questions than what is taught in school, thereby better preparing the student for exams. However, should the student have any certain topic that he or she does not seem to understand, I would also be able to walk the student through that certain topic at a pace that the student is comfortable with such that it would be easier for him or her to gain a better understanding of the topic under study. Notice in advance of the topics the student would like me to cover would be very much appreciated because it would also allow better time utilization during the tuition session.
